Faculty has improved over time, and it is a good place to both learn and enjoy.

Placements: 80 percent of students were placed in my Computer branch. The highest package was offered by Juspay, around 24 LPA, and the lowest was 3 LPA by TCS. Top recruiting companies included Juspay, ICICI Lombard, and HSBC. My college did not offer any internships. It directly provided placement opportunities. The top roles offered were Software Engineer and Data Analyst.
